JavaTM Platform
Standard Ed. 6

java.awt.event
インタフェース WindowFocusListener

すべてのスーパーインタフェース:
EventListener
既知の実装クラスの一覧:
AWTEventMulticaster, BasicToolBarUI.FrameListener, JMenu.WinListener, WindowAdapter

public interface WindowFocusListener
extends EventListener

WindowEvents を受け取るためのリスナーインタフェースです。 WINDOW_GAINED_FOCUS および WINDOW_LOST_FOCUS が含まれます。WindowEvent の処理に関連するクラスは、このインタフェースに含まれるすべてのメソッドを定義してこのインタフェースを実装するか、関連するメソッドだけをオーバーライドして abstract クラス WindowAdapter を拡張します。そのようなクラスから作成されたリスナーオブジェクトは、WindowaddWindowFocusListener メソッドを使って、Window に登録されます。Window が、オープン、クローズ、アクティブ化、非アクティブ化、アイコン化、非アイコン化されるか、または、フォーカスが Window に移動するか、あるいは Window から移動したために、その状態が変更されると、リスナーオブジェクトの関連するメソッドが呼び出され、そのメソッドに WindowEvent が渡されます。

導入されたバージョン:
1.4
関連項目:
WindowAdapter, WindowEvent, 「Tutorial: Writing a Window Listener」

メソッドの概要
 void windowGainedFocus(WindowEvent e)
          Window がフォーカスされた Window に設定されたときに呼び出されます。
 void windowLostFocus(WindowEvent e)
          Window がフォーカスされた Window ではなくなったときに呼び出されます。
 

メソッドの詳細

windowGainedFocus

void windowGainedFocus(WindowEvent e)
Window がフォーカスされた Window に設定されたときに呼び出されます。これは、この Window またはそのサブコンポーネントの 1 つがキーボードイベントを受け取ることを意味します。


windowLostFocus

void windowLostFocus(WindowEvent e)
Window がフォーカスされた Window ではなくなったときに呼び出されます。これは、キーボードイベントがこの Window またはそのサブコンポーネントに送られなくなることを意味します。


JavaTM Platform
Standard Ed. 6

バグの報告と機能のリクエスト
さらに詳しい API リファレンスおよび開発者ドキュメントについては、Java SE 開発者用ドキュメントを参照してください。開発者向けの詳細な解説、概念の概要、用語の定義、バグの回避策、およびコード実例が含まれています。

Copyright 2006 Sun Microsystems, Inc. All rights reserved. Use is subject to license terms. Documentation Redistribution Policy も参照してください。